Do I Need to Adjust Weight Distribution System After Installing Air Springs
Question:
I currently use a equalizer 4 way hitch ,I purchased a set of firestone air springs , if i put my truck at the same distance from the ground as it was without the trailer ,do i need to adjust the equalizer hitch?
asked by: Greg R
Helpful Expert Reply:
If the truck is still the same distance from the ground after the air spring installation as it was before the air spring installation then you may not need to adjust the equalizer hitch as long as the truck is level with the trailer. The point of the adjustable weight distribution shank is to keep the truck level with the trailer frame.
The weight distribution head angle adjustment on part # EQ37100ET, and other weight distribution systems like it, allows you to add or take away tension in the spring bars. It all depends on if you are level with the trailer after you hook it up. You may need to do some adjusting.
